You mean the connector itself goes bad?


If it's the type you lay the wire in and compress between two covers with prongs that puncture the wire, no they don't go bad quickly. It's usually that you didn't hit the wire at the middle. It's work for a while but build up corrosion and quit. Did you use the goop that come with it?
